Discover compatible riders nearby

Find Riding Buddy on Home shows a paginated list of nearby riders after location permission. Refresh results and compare name, location, primary motorcycle, online state and same-brand signals.

Build the connection safely

  • Open a rider row to review the public profile fields the server permits.
  • Send a friend request and manage incoming, outgoing, friends and blocked states.
  • Start a direct message only after you become mutual friends.
  • Report an inappropriate account with a reason; RiderHub automatically hides and blocks it.
  • Confirm Block as a separate action; the result list refreshes against the new privacy state.

Privacy comes before every result

  • Profiles can be public, friends-only or private.
  • A restricted profile never invents zero values or exposes the reason for hidden data.
  • Blocked, private or unavailable accounts may share the same safe unavailable state.
  • The list shows only fields the app is allowed to reveal, never precise private location data.
